This NSN is assigned to Item Name Code (INC) 04549. [A BRICK MANUFACTURED ESSENTIALLY OF TEMPERATURE STABLE MINERAL AGGREGATES, FORMED BY PRESSURE INTO A SPECIAL SHAPE. IT IS SUITABLE FOR CONSTRUCTING INDUSTRIAL AND BOILER FURNACES. RESISTANCE TO TEMPERATURE IS THE PRIME CHARACTERISTIC, BUT RESISTANCE TO ONE OR MORE OF THE DESTRUCTIVE ACTIONS OF SPALLING, ABRASION, SLAG ATTACK, OR LOAD IS USUALLY REQUIRED. EXCLUDES:BRICK, INSULATING, HIGH TEMPERATURE.]. This item does not have a nuclear hardened feature or any other critical feature such as tolerance, fit restriction or application.
